Common (vernacular) names applied to California vascular plants

compiled by Elizabeth Painter

up to date as of May 1, 2016

Common names (also referred to as vernacular names) are applied differently at different times and places by different users. This list is compiled from many sources and is intended to be as comprehensive as possible. It is not intended to indicate which common name is correct or preferred. TaxonFerocactus viridescens
groupEudicots
FamilyCactaceae
Family common name(s)cactus
Genus common name(s)ferocactus
Species common name(s)San Diego barrel-cactus; San Diego barrel cactus; San Diego barrelcactus; San Diego barrel; coastal barrel-cactus; coastal barrel cactus; coastal barrel; coast barrel cactus; coast barrel; keg cactus; green-stemmed viznaga; green-stem viznaga; hidden bisnaga; hidden visnaga
 
 
Common name(s) generally applied to other taxa or multiple taxabarrel cactus, barrel-cactus, small barrel cactus, keg cactus, horse-crippler cactus, horse crippler cactus are applied to multiple Cactaceae taxa; bisnaga, biznaga, visnaga, viznaga are applied to taxa in multiple families
